What are baby ladybugs called?

A ladybug "baby," like that of most other insects, is a larva. It then pupates and finally emerges as a full-grown ladybug.

What is a female baby ladybug called?

The 'Lady' in the word 'Ladybug' doesn't refer to the gender of the beetle. Male or female, they are all called Ladybugs, or sometimes Ladybirds. The baby ones would be referred to as a larva or a pupa, depending on what stage it is.
